PT Freeport Indonesia, a Freeport-McMoRan Company, Builds a New School for Early Childhood Education in Papua

PT Freeport Indonesia, in partnership with the local government, has recently inaugurated a new school building for young children in the Banti village of Papua, Indonesia. The school building houses a new library in addition to classrooms for early childhood development.

University of Windsor Students Named National Champions of Youth Empowerment

Upon learning that 60 per cent of students leave high school without basic financial education, students from the University of Windsor created Youthrive, an intensive 10-week one-on-one consulting and financial literacy education program focused on accelerating young entrepreneurs.

Whirlpool Corporation Opens New EMEA Headquarters in Milan

Italian Prime Minister Paolo Gentiloni dedicated the new headquarters of Whirlpool EMEA (Europe, Middle East and Africa) in Pero (Milan) today. Whirlpool Corporation President and Chief Operating Officer Marc Bitzer, Whirlpool EMEA President and Whirlpool Corporation Executive Vice-President Esther Berrozpe Galindo, Regione Lombardia President Roberto Maroni, and the Mayor of Pero Maria Rosa Belotti attended the ceremony.
